Max Liebermann's East Frisian Peasants Eating Supper, created in 1893, captures a moment of simple, rural life in this evocative charcoal and chalk drawing. The scene takes place inside a humble farmhouse, where a group of East Frisian peasants gather around a long wooden table, deep in conversation as they finish their evening meal. The room is filled with the warmth and comfort of home, with the flickering light of a candle casting long shadows on the rough-hewn furniture and the worn wooden floor. Children play at the feet of the adults, adding a sense of liveliness and joy to the scene. The men, dressed in traditional farm attire, sit with their hands resting on the table or leaning on their chairs, while the women, clad in aprons and headscarves, serve and attend to their families. The artist's skillful use of charcoal and chalk creates a rich, textured rendering of the scene, with the subtle variations in tone and shade bringing the figures and their surroundings to life. East Frisian Peasants Eating Supper is a poignant reminder of the agricultural heritage of Germany in the late 19th century. Liebermann's masterful depiction of the everyday lives of rural laborers invites us to appreciate the beauty and dignity of their work and the close-knit communities they formed. This drawing is a cherished addition to the collections of the National Gallery of Art in Washington D.C., and a testament to the enduring power of art to capture and preserve the human experience.
